Transaction bd53fad64e4458f15e157fb307a97aca2ce1c3d9571a9a1daae4e0fa8e7d3a77

30 Input
1 Outputs
  • bd53fad64e4458f15e157fb307a97aca2ce1c3d9571a9a1daae4e0fa8e7d3a77:0
  • value  5716746
    address  16WRJDHbFawtsohdaSNp34Y3cXmtvJJU8Q